It’s big, it’s beautiful and ‘one of Beverley’s best kept secrets’
‘Cleverly-designed’ bungalow in a private setting on the market for £1.2m

A beautiful bungalow occupying a large and private plot at Molescroft, Beverley, is on the market for £1.2m.
The property, in Church Green – a location offering space and seclusion for a large family – is for sale with EweMove, who describe it as a “cleverly designed” home, built by the renowned local builder Peter Ward Homes. The agent said: “Church Green is a niche cul-de-sac off Church Road, Molescroft and must be one of Beverley's best kept secrets.”
The bungalow boasts four bedrooms, all of them en-suite, and four reception rooms in the shape of a lounge, a family room, a snug and a library. There is a spacious and modern open-plan kitchen diner.
Set in a large plot “surrounded by a curtain of hedges and trees”, the property also includes the Coach House, made up of a double garage and a single garage. A corridor separates the two, with a cloakroom off, and stairs lead to the first floor, which has been used as a home office in the past but offers a very versatile space for a variety of purposes.
A tarmac driveway stretches along the front of the L-shaped property and turns in front of the Coach House, after which it widens to provide plenty of parking for a number of vehicles. There is an expanse of lawn to the front of the property and neat planted borders; the rear includes a large expanse of lawn and a patio area.
